Well, the Wish You Were Here jersey is not available yet. Mid-January they say. But I got a Dark Side of the Moon jersey for Christmas. I wore it to my club's weekly winter trainer ride last night. When I peeled it off I discovered an "Easter egg."

Inside one of the three rear pockets is printed, "The lunatic is on the grass." The center pocket says, "The lunatic is in the hall." The last pocket, naturally says, "The lunatic is in my head."
